Bruna Surfistinha — born Raquel Pacheco — is a polarizing figure whose life story leapt from anonymous blog confessions to bestselling memoir, a major Brazilian film, and widespread cultural debate. Her memoir and public persona raised questions about sex work, agency, exploitation, and the media’s appetite for scandal.
